Simple Advice to Sellers – Use Tape. Regularly.

I’m a relatively new seller. That mean, there is lot more to learn. The very first important and expensive lesson I learned was – “Use Tape!”

I was selling some playstation games and it all went quite well. Been a new ebay seller, I was quite cheerful when auctions ended successfully, and wanted to ship those games faster as possible. I had this idea, if you ship them fast, buyers may consider giving good rating. And everybody likes good rating.

I grab nice looking bubble envelop. Put the brand new, sealed game inside. Print shipping labels and added shipping insurance. Those bubble envelop have generous layer of glue, the type that you don’t have to lick. Closed it and drop it in the post office. The lady in the USPS counter looks quite gorgeous. So I thank her generously, and came home. Well done.  I was waiting for good rating from my buyer.

Buyer contacted me in two days. But not with the good rating I was expecting earnestly. For everybody’s disappointment, my buyer received the package, closed and neat – but with an empty DVD box inside – that mean – no game disk or the booklet. So what shall I do? I check the buyer’s reviews and he have 100% good reviews so far. I refund the buyer total payment, and file an insurance request with USPS, hoping I may recover my lost. But I’m not sure how good the insurance thing will work out for me, since the package was delivered without any sign of damages. I will keep you update how USPS treat me with my lost.

I talked to my mail lady next day and told her the trouble I had. She was kind enough to stop all her work for 10 minute and listen to my whining. And at the end she said, ‘yes. Things like that can happen. They can open the envelop, take things out and reseal it’. So I believe that is what may have happened. Some USPS worker with lot of free time on his hand, opened the package quite easily, since I didn’t use any tapes to close it. Take the dvds out. Glue the envelop back again with the free stationary given by the USPS, and went to do the same thing to some other package with ebay logo on it.  

I lean my lesson. Now I use strong tapes over the envelop when I close it, so when someone try to open it, it rip off the paper and leave a visible mark on it. Also added note underneath it, “do not accept if the seal is broken”. I hope that can discourage anyone thinking of stealing my items on the way to the delivery. Well, if the total package gets lost altogether – I don’t mind, so I can easily get my insurance.

Folks, use tape.
